What is Business Development?

Business development refers to the strategies and activities that help organizations expand their reach, increase revenue, and achieve sustainable growth. Unlike sales, which focuses on closing immediate deals, business development takes a long-term, holistic approach to growth by building networks, entering new markets, and forming strategic partnerships.

Business development professionals serve as the bridge between strategy and execution. They analyze markets, identify opportunities, and collaborate with multiple departments—including marketing, sales, and product development—to ensure business growth.

Key Responsibilities in Business Development

A career in business development is diverse and dynamic. Common responsibilities include:

  • Conducting market research to identify opportunities.

  • Building and nurturing client relationships.

  • Negotiating partnerships and collaborations.

  • Designing growth strategies aligned with organizational goals.

  • Coordinating with sales, marketing, and product teams.

  • Analyzing performance data to improve strategies.

This variety ensures that no two days in business development are ever the same.

Career Opportunities in Business Development

Business development offers multiple career paths depending on experience and industry. Some common roles include:

  1. Business Development Executive – Entry-level position focusing on lead generation and outreach.

  2. Business Development Manager – Oversees client accounts, strategies, and partnerships.

  3. Strategic Partnership Manager – Builds alliances with other businesses for mutual benefit.

  4. Sales Development Representative (SDR) – Bridges the gap between marketing leads and sales teams.

  5. Growth Manager – Focuses on scaling business operations and revenue growth.

  6. Director of Business Development – Senior role shaping long-term strategies and managing large teams.

Challenges in Business Development

Like every career, business development also has its challenges:

  • High-Pressure Environment – Meeting targets and driving growth can be demanding.

  • Rejection and Setbacks – Not every opportunity results in success.

  • Constant Market Changes – Professionals must stay updated with global trends.

  • Long Sales Cycles – Some deals take months or even years to close.
